Bristol Rovers is excited to launch a limited edition collaboration with leading sports apparel brand Art of Football.
The collection launches exclusively in-store from 10am on Saturday 27 September, when the Gas host Salford City in a Sky Bet League Two clash.
Art of Football create hand crafted designs that capture the energy and emotion from magical moments in football.
The collection comprises four products - a hoodie, a sweatshirt, and two t-shirts - featuring two designs, one with five classic Bristol Rovers Men's shirts, and the other with five classic Women's shirts.
Featured in the launch video are former player Nick Anderton, Assistant Groundsman Luke Bayliss, Stadium Announcer Lance Cook, and Reagan Lewis, twin sister of Bristol Rovers Women Captain Rianne Bourne-Hallett.
